-nizz-ass-ero Italian verbal suffixes: -nizz- (verb formation), -ass- (imperfect subjunctive), -ero (3rd person plural imperfect subjunctive)

egemonizzassero
7 syllables15 letters
e·ge·mo·ni·zzas·se·ro
/e.ɡe.mo.nit.tsas.se.ro/
verb

The word 'egemonizzassero' is a complex Italian verb form. Syllabification follows standard Italian rules, considering vowel-consonant sequences and geminate consonants. Stress falls on the penultimate syllable. The word is morphologically complex, derived from Greek and Latin roots with Italian verbal suffixes.
